Output 973e16817cf9783b892d4e5df58324db5e813599dd55df0fe42fd3c220f16e4a:1

value
313430
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dcd33ab25f6e319f1f8d9039d81e3ce04e7c9ff4 OP_EQUAL
address
3MpddDPXxxVLaHw6HA26Gf28i1C1iGdxLK
transaction
973e16817cf9783b892d4e5df58324db5e813599dd55df0fe42fd3c220f16e4a
spent
true